Louisiana's humid climate and heavy rainfall can put a consistent strain on septic systems. These conditions can accelerate the decomposition of waste, making regular pumping essential to prevent solids from building up. For many homes that rely on septic tanks, proactive maintenance is key to ensuring the system can handle the local environment and prevent costly issues.

How often should a septic tank be pumped in Louisiana?

In Louisiana, pumping your septic tank every 3 to 5 years is a good general practice. This can vary depending on your household's water usage and the size of your tank. Regular pumping is crucial to prevent solid waste from causing clogs.

How long do septic tanks usually last in Louisiana?

Septic tanks in Louisiana can typically last for 20 to 30 years or even longer with consistent maintenance. Regular pumping is a vital part of this care. Neglecting this essential service can lead to premature failure and significantly more expensive repairs.
